我希望在 Python 中將整個資料幀除以 2
資料
id date aa bb cc dd
staff Q1 23 6 2 6 0
staff2 Q2 23 6 2 6 0
想要的
id date aa bb cc dd
staff Q1 23 3 1 3 0
staff2 Q2 23 3 1 3 0
正在做
df.div(2)
任何建議表示贊賞
接收型別錯誤 - 更新
希望將數字列除以 2
uj5u.com熱心網友回復:
首先我們需要選擇數字
df.update(df.select_dtypes(np.number)/2)
uj5u.com熱心網友回復:
檢查列名的 float 64 和 int 64 資料型別,然后使用該列除以 2 結果
for col in df.select_dtypes(include=['float64', 'int64']).columns:
df[col] = df[col] / 2
轉載請註明出處,本文鏈接:https://www.uj5u.com/ruanti/357504.html
上一篇:pandas用函式回傳的值替換0
